Output ec3674a9b75d8eb26acd25a81a508836d780bfc78a2fa828fa1f152583385c11:46

value
149454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 387ecd53f6a65a9016acb053dc609e590b7dfee7 OP_EQUAL
address
36qjfeYAPKNLLnuGjwQY3c7mrkmXCoZDXm
transaction
ec3674a9b75d8eb26acd25a81a508836d780bfc78a2fa828fa1f152583385c11
spent
true